Bureau of Refugees, Freedmen and Abandoned Lands,
Head Quarters 10th Sub-District of Virginia.
Alexandria, Va., July 30th 1868.

Bvt. Brig. Gen O. Brown
Bureau R.F. and A. Lands
Richmond, Va

General,
I have the honor to apply for a leave of absence for twenty days, with permission to apply for an extension of ten days, for the purpose of having a change of air, and a relaxation from the details and cares of business, which have been constantly upon me for some months

Bvt. Capt. Edward Field 4th Arty. A.S.A.C. 1" Div. 10th Sub-Dist. can attend to the duties of my position,, during my absence, and should anything occur demanding my presence, he will be advised of my address from day to day, and can telegraph me to that effect, and I will immediately return.
